![計算機二級公共基礎知識總結_第1頁](http://file4.renrendoc.com/view10/M02/30/37/wKhkGWWjoFWAAusWAAIOagO3aKc762.jpg)
![計算機二級公共基礎知識總結_第2頁](http://file4.renrendoc.com/view10/M02/30/37/wKhkGWWjoFWAAusWAAIOagO3aKc7622.jpg)
![計算機二級公共基礎知識總結_第3頁](http://file4.renrendoc.com/view10/M02/30/37/wKhkGWWjoFWAAusWAAIOagO3aKc7623.jpg)
![計算機二級公共基礎知識總結_第4頁](http://file4.renrendoc.com/view10/M02/30/37/wKhkGWWjoFWAAusWAAIOagO3aKc7624.jpg)
![計算機二級公共基礎知識總結_第5頁](http://file4.renrendoc.com/view10/M02/30/37/wKhkGWWjoFWAAusWAAIOagO3aKc7625.jpg)
版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
計算機二級公共基礎知識總結匯報人:202X-01-07CATALOGUE目錄計算機基礎知識數(shù)據(jù)結構與算法操作系統(tǒng)程序設計語言與程序設計方法軟件工程基礎數(shù)據(jù)庫設計基礎01計算機基礎知識0102機械計算機時代1946年第一臺電子計算機ENIAC誕生,主要用于軍事和科學研究。晶體管計算機時代20世紀50年代初,晶體管取代真空管,計算機速度更快、體積更小。小型集成電路計算機時代20世紀70年代初,集成電路技術進一步發(fā)展,計算機性能和可靠性得到顯著提升。大規(guī)模集成電路計算機時代20世紀80年代開始,大規(guī)模集成電路技術迅速發(fā)展,計算機性能和功能得到極大提升。人工智能和云計算時代21世紀初,隨著人工智能和云計算技術的快速發(fā)展,計算機的應用領域不斷擴大。030405計算機的發(fā)展歷程計算機運算速度極快,可以進行大規(guī)模數(shù)值計算和數(shù)據(jù)處理。高速運算計算機可以自動執(zhí)行程序,對各種設備進行精確控制。自動化控制計算機可以存儲大量的數(shù)據(jù)和信息,方便用戶隨時訪問和使用。信息存儲計算機在各個領域都有廣泛應用,如科學計算、數(shù)據(jù)處理、工業(yè)控制、自動化制造、電子商務、教育、醫(yī)療等。應用領域廣泛計算機的特點及應用領域巨型機運算速度快、存儲容量大,主要用于尖端科學研究領域。結構簡單、成本低、操作簡便,適合中小型企業(yè)和機構使用。普及率高、功能強大、應用廣泛,包括臺式機、筆記本和平板電腦等。體積小、功耗低、可靠性高,廣泛應用于智能家居、智能制造等領域。未來計算機將朝著更高性能、更低功耗、更智能化的方向發(fā)展,同時云計算和人工智能等技術的融合也將為計算機的應用帶來更多可能性。小型機嵌入式系統(tǒng)發(fā)展趨勢個人電腦計算機的分類及發(fā)展趨勢02數(shù)據(jù)結構與算法數(shù)據(jù)結構的基本概念數(shù)據(jù)結構是計算機存儲、組織數(shù)據(jù)的方式,是相互之間存在一種或多種特定關系的數(shù)據(jù)元素的集合。數(shù)據(jù)結構主要研究數(shù)據(jù)的邏輯結構、物理結構和數(shù)據(jù)的運算。數(shù)據(jù)結構的分類根據(jù)不同的分類標準,可以將數(shù)據(jù)結構分為線性結構和非線性結構,基本結構和復合結構,靜態(tài)結構和動態(tài)結構等。數(shù)據(jù)結構的基本概念線性結構是最基本的數(shù)據(jù)結構,包括線性表、棧、隊列等。線性表是最簡單的線性結構,棧和隊列是特殊的線性表。線性結構非線性結構包括樹形結構、圖形結構等。樹形結構是一組具有層次關系的節(jié)點,圖形結構是一組具有任意關系的節(jié)點。非線性結構常見的數(shù)據(jù)結構類型算法的概念01算法是指一系列解決問題的清晰指令,是計算機科學中用來實現(xiàn)問題求解的一系列明確、可執(zhí)行的步驟。算法的特性02一個良好的算法應該具有正確性、可讀性、健壯性、效率和可擴展性等特性。算法分析03算法分析是對算法的時間復雜度和空間復雜度的評估和分析,以確定算法的效率。時間復雜度主要關注算法執(zhí)行所需的時間,空間復雜度主要關注算法所需存儲空間的大小。算法設計與分析03操作系統(tǒng)操作系統(tǒng)是計算機系統(tǒng)中用于管理計算機硬件和軟件資源的一種軟件,是計算機系統(tǒng)的核心組成部分。操作系統(tǒng)定義操作系統(tǒng)的主要作用是提供人機交互界面、管理計算機硬件和軟件資源、實現(xiàn)計算機系統(tǒng)的高效運行。操作系統(tǒng)作用根據(jù)不同的分類標準,可以將操作系統(tǒng)分為批處理操作系統(tǒng)、分時操作系統(tǒng)、實時操作系統(tǒng)、網(wǎng)絡操作系統(tǒng)等。操作系統(tǒng)分類操作系統(tǒng)的基本概念WindowsLinuxMacOSAndroid常見的操作系統(tǒng)類型01020304微軟公司開發(fā)的桌面操作系統(tǒng),廣泛應用于個人計算機領域。自由軟件項目,源代碼公開,可免費使用,具有高度的可定制性。蘋果公司開發(fā)的桌面操作系統(tǒng),具有獨特的用戶界面和強大的多媒體功能?;贚inux的移動操作系統(tǒng),廣泛應用于智能手機和平板電腦領域。操作系統(tǒng)通過進程管理機制實現(xiàn)對計算機系統(tǒng)中多個程序的調度和執(zhí)行。進程管理操作系統(tǒng)負責內存的分配、回收、保護等任務,確保程序的正常運行。內存管理操作系統(tǒng)提供文件存儲、檢索、刪除等功能,實現(xiàn)對計算機系統(tǒng)中各類數(shù)據(jù)的統(tǒng)一管理。文件管理操作系統(tǒng)負責對計算機系統(tǒng)中各類設備進行管理,包括設備的驅動、控制和通信等。設備管理操作系統(tǒng)的功能及原理04程序設計語言與程序設計方法程序設計語言的基本概念用于描述計算機程序的一種人工語言,包括指令、數(shù)據(jù)類型、運算符等。接近自然語言或數(shù)學符號的語言,易于理解和編寫,編譯型語言和解釋型語言。與計算機硬件直接交互的語言,如匯編語言。用于描述算法流程的簡化語言,不依賴于特定編程語言。程序設計語言高級語言低級語言偽代碼一種通用的、過程式的計算機程序設計語言,支持結構化編程、內存管理等功能。C語言一種面向對象的、跨平臺的高級編程語言,支持多線程編程和網(wǎng)絡應用。Java語言一種解釋型的高級編程語言,語法簡潔易懂,支持多種編程范式。Python語言一種腳本語言,用于網(wǎng)頁開發(fā),實現(xiàn)動態(tài)交互效果。JavaScript語言常見的程序設計語言類型從整體到局部,先設計高層次結構,再逐步細化。自頂向下設計自底向上設計模塊化設計主次關系處理從局部到整體,先實現(xiàn)基本功能,再組合成完整程序。將程序劃分為獨立、可復用的模塊,降低復雜度,便于維護和擴展。優(yōu)先處理主要功能和核心問題,再解決次要問題。程序設計的基本方法與原則05軟件工程基礎軟件工程的目標是提高軟件的質量和生產(chǎn)率,以滿足用戶的需求。軟件工程的核心是管理,包括項目管理、質量管理、配置管理等。軟件工程是一門研究軟件開發(fā)和維護的工程學科,它采用工程化的方法進行軟件開發(fā)和維護。軟件工程的基本概念軟件開發(fā)生命周期是指從軟件的需求分析、設計、編碼、測試到發(fā)布和維護的整個過程。軟件開發(fā)生命周期可以分為瀑布模型、迭代模型、敏捷開發(fā)等不同的開發(fā)模型。在軟件開發(fā)生命周期中,每個階段都有其特定的任務和輸出,以確保軟件開發(fā)的順利進行。軟件開發(fā)生命周期軟件測試是軟件開發(fā)過程中必不可少的一環(huán),它通過發(fā)現(xiàn)和修復軟件中的缺陷來提高軟件的質量。軟件測試的方法包括黑盒測試、白盒測試、灰盒測試等,每種方法都有其特定的應用場景。軟件維護是對已經(jīng)發(fā)布的軟件進行修改和完善的過程,包括改正性維護、適應性維護、完善性維護和預防性維護等。軟件測試與維護06數(shù)據(jù)庫設計基礎一個存儲數(shù)據(jù)的系統(tǒng),可以長期存儲大量的數(shù)據(jù),并允許用戶檢索、更新和管理這些數(shù)據(jù)。數(shù)據(jù)庫數(shù)據(jù)模型數(shù)據(jù)視圖描述數(shù)據(jù)、數(shù)據(jù)關系以及數(shù)據(jù)操作的抽象表示,是數(shù)據(jù)庫設計的核心。數(shù)據(jù)庫中數(shù)據(jù)的特定表示,可以隱藏數(shù)據(jù)的細節(jié),只顯示用戶需要看到的信息。030201數(shù)據(jù)庫的基本概念
關系數(shù)據(jù)庫管理系統(tǒng)關系數(shù)據(jù)庫使用關系模型來組織和存儲數(shù)據(jù)的數(shù)據(jù)庫。關系數(shù)據(jù)庫管理系統(tǒng)用于創(chuàng)建、管理關系數(shù)據(jù)庫的軟件。關系數(shù)據(jù)庫語言用于查詢、更新和管理關系數(shù)據(jù)庫的SQL語言。包括結構
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 政務(含公共服務)服務平臺項目建設方案X
- 未來教育領域中如何利用移動支付進行教育資源的優(yōu)化配置和共享研究
- 環(huán)境保護教育推廣與實踐
- 國慶節(jié)團隊旅行活動方案
- 環(huán)境藝術設計中的視覺體驗與審美需求
- 生態(tài)環(huán)保理念在辦公空間的設計實踐
- 環(huán)保材料在環(huán)境藝術設計中的應用前景
- 生活用紙的創(chuàng)新設計與實踐案例分享
- 《2 顏色填充和橡皮擦工具》(說課稿)-2023-2024學年五年級下冊綜合實踐活動吉美版
- 2023八年級物理上冊 第四章 光現(xiàn)象第5節(jié) 光的色散說課稿 (新版)新人教版
- 工業(yè)企業(yè)電源快速切換裝置設計配置導則
- 某有限公司雙螺紋偏轉型防松防盜螺母商業(yè)計劃書
- 年產(chǎn)3萬噸噴氣紡、3萬噸氣流紡生產(chǎn)線項目節(jié)能評估報告
- 外研版九年級英語上冊單元測試題全套帶答案
- 2023年云南省貴金屬新材料控股集團有限公司招聘筆試題庫及答案解析
- GB/T 1094.1-2013電力變壓器第1部分:總則
- 2023年益陽醫(yī)學高等??茖W校單招綜合素質考試筆試題庫及答案解析
- 胸外科診療指南和操作規(guī)范
- 電網(wǎng)基本知識
- 民法原理與實務課程教學大綱
- 鋼筋混凝土框架結構工程監(jiān)理的質量控制
評論
0/150
提交評論